About The Position

Reuters is seeking a Data Scientist to develop artificial intelligence products for Reuters News. This role involves creating deep learning, machine learning, and artificial intelligence models using advanced research and cloud platforms, with a focus on data preparation, testing, and performance evaluation. The Data Scientist will work on news technology projects supporting global newsrooms and Reuters' news production strategy, collaborating with various stakeholders to define technological approaches for news dissemination. The position is part of a collaborative team working closely with the CTO on AI and non-AI software products for real-time newsroom operations. The role requires a strategic and practical approach to building news solutions that enhance the use of multimedia content for rapid global information dissemination. Responsibilities include gathering and preparing datasets, training analytical models to understand news consumption, and evaluating systems using performance metrics for strategic decision-making. The Data Scientist will also act as a listener and problem solver, working with editorial and technological stakeholders to identify needs, areas for innovation, and establish the best course of action for delivering user-centric solutions.

Requirements

  • Demonstrable experience in Python with strong grasp of software engineering standard methodologies such as code-reusability, modularity, use of repos, etc.
  • Demonstrable, applied experience in ML, deep learning or Computer Vision
  • Demonstrated expertise in machine learning and artificial intelligence tasks such as feature engineering, image processing, NLP, or model training.
  • Knowledge and experience with recent machine learning frameworks
  • Demonstrated experience in building and maintaining high quality, robust and maintainable code
  • Experience in automation, system monitoring, and cloud-native applications, with familiarity in AWS or Azure
  • Ability to work with large data sets, including preparation, labelling, and analysis tasks
  • Comfortable with Agile practices
  • Comfortable with giving web presentations on investigations or work
